From 49c8eaa4685308becd0c8d3d917a1398f0f35230 Mon Sep 17 00:00:00 2001 From: gbrochar Date: Fri, 27 Nov 2020 13:40:14 +0100 Subject: [PATCH] fix shift wasd bug --- src/client/ux.ts |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/src/client/ux.ts b/src/client/ux.ts index 19fc742..1ad26f6 100644 --- a/src/client/ux.ts +++ b/src/client/ux.ts @@ -26,16 +26,16 @@ export function initUX(context: any, canvas: any) { } }); $(document).keydown((event) => { - if (event.key == 'w') { + if (event.key == 'w' || event.key == 'W') { context.params.keyboard.w = true; } - if (event.key == 's') { + if (event.key == 's' || event.key == 'S') { context.params.keyboard.s = true; } - if (event.key == 'a') { + if (event.key == 'a' || event.key == 'A') { context.params.keyboard.a = true; } - if (event.key == 'd') { + if (event.key == 'd' || event.key == 'D') { context.params.keyboard.d = true; } if (event.key == 'Shift') { @@ -46,16 +46,16 @@ export function initUX(context: any, canvas: any) { } }); $(document).keyup((event) => { - if (event.key == 'w') { + if (event.key == 'w' || event.key == 'W') { context.params.keyboard.w = false; } - if (event.key == 's') { + if (event.key == 's' || event.key == 'S') { context.params.keyboard.s = false; } - if (event.key == 'a') { + if (event.key == 'a' || event.key == 'A') { context.params.keyboard.a = false; } - if (event.key == 'd') { + if (event.key == 'd' || event.key == 'D') { context.params.keyboard.d = false; } if (event.key == 'Shift') {